AN UNBIASED VIEW OF NET33

An Unbiased View of Net33

An Unbiased View of Net33

Blog Article

ENTERBRAIN grants to Licensee a non-special, non-assignable, price-free license to use the RTP Software program just for the function to Participate in the GAME developed and distributed by RPG MAKER XP users who shall total the registration course of action.

By owning Every single participant send out its Command packets to all the Other individuals, Each individual can independently observe the quantity of individuals. This variety is utilized to work out the rate at which the packets are despatched, as stated in Area 6.two. 4. A fourth, OPTIONAL function is usually to Express minimal session Management info, as an example participant identification to be displayed from the consumer interface. That is more than likely being practical in "loosely controlled" classes exactly where participants enter and depart with out membership Handle or parameter negotiation. RTCP serves as a hassle-free channel to reach the many individuals, but It isn't essentially predicted to assist all of the control conversation necessities of an software. A higher-amount session Command protocol, that's over and above the scope of the doc, can be required. Capabilities 1-3 Ought to be Employed in all environments, but specifically in the IP multicast surroundings. RTP application designers Ought to avoid mechanisms that will only do the job in unicast manner and will never scale to greater quantities. Transmission of RTCP MAY be controlled individually for senders and receivers, as described in Part 6.two, for instances like unidirectional links the place opinions from receivers is impossible. Schulzrinne, et al. Specifications Monitor [Website page twenty]

RFC 3550 RTP July 2003 to provide the data essential by a selected application and can typically be integrated into the applying processing rather then being applied to be a independent layer. RTP is often a protocol framework that is certainly deliberately not comprehensive. This doc specifies These features predicted to get typical throughout all the applications for which RTP can be proper. Contrary to common protocols where extra capabilities might be accommodated by producing the protocol much more normal or by incorporating an alternative system that may require parsing, RTP is meant to become personalized by modifications and/or additions to the headers as needed. Illustrations are offered in Sections 5.three and 6.four.three. Therefore, Together with this doc, a whole specification of RTP for a specific application will require one or more companion files (see Portion thirteen): o a profile specification document, which defines a set of payload style codes as well as their mapping to payload formats (e.g., media encodings). A profile may also outline extensions or modifications to RTP that are distinct to a particular course of programs.

In certain fields where by a far more compact representation is appropriate, only the middle 32 bits are employed; that is definitely, the small sixteen bits of the integer part plus the superior sixteen bits in the fractional component. The significant 16 bits from the integer section need to be determined independently. An implementation is not really required to operate the Network Time Protocol to be able to use RTP. Other time resources, or none in any respect, can be made use of (see the description in the NTP timestamp industry in Part six.4.1). Nevertheless, operating NTP can be valuable for synchronizing streams transmitted from different hosts. The NTP timestamp will wrap all-around to zero some time during the year 2036, but for RTP uses, only dissimilarities amongst pairs of NTP timestamps are employed. As long as the pairs of timestamps can be assumed for being within sixty eight decades of one another, working with modular arithmetic for subtractions and comparisons will make the wraparound irrelevant. Schulzrinne, et al. Benchmarks Observe [Web page 12]

Each the SR and RR kinds include things like zero or more reception report blocks, just one for each of your synchronization sources from which this receiver has been given RTP knowledge packets Because the very last report. Reviews usually are not issued for contributing resources mentioned in the CSRC listing. Each and every reception report block supplies data about the info acquired from the particular source indicated in that block. Because a greatest of 31 reception report blocks will fit in an SR or RR packet, supplemental RR packets Really should be stacked after the Preliminary SR or RR packet as needed to incorporate the reception reviews for all sources listened to in the course of the interval since the past report. If you will find too many resources to suit all the mandatory RR packets into a single compound RTCP packet with out exceeding the MTU of your community path, then only the subset that can in good shape into a single MTU Need to be included in Every single interval. The subsets SHOULD be picked round-robin across various intervals so that all sources are noted. The subsequent sections determine the formats of the two studies, how They might be prolonged inside a profile-specific way if an software demands additional opinions facts, And the way the stories can be applied. Information of reception reporting by translators and mixers is offered in Segment seven. Schulzrinne, et al. Benchmarks Track [Web site 35]

[3] RTP is considered to be the first standard for audio/video transportation in IP networks and is made use of having an related profile and payload format.[4] The design of RTP relies on the architectural basic principle referred to as application-layer framing exactly where protocol capabilities are carried out in the application in contrast to the operating system's protocol stack.

Hence, packets that get there late will not be counted as misplaced, as well as the decline could be damaging if you will find duplicates. The volume of packets expected is outlined to generally be the extended last sequence range obtained, as outlined future, considerably less the Original sequence range been given. This can be calculated as shown in Appendix A.3. prolonged maximum sequence range been given: 32 bits The minimal 16 bits incorporate the best sequence number received in an RTP knowledge packet from source SSRC_n, plus the most important sixteen bits prolong that sequence amount Along with the corresponding depend of sequence number cycles, which can be preserved in accordance with the algorithm in Appendix A.1. Note that unique receivers within the same session will make diverse extensions for the sequence quantity if their start out instances differ noticeably. interarrival jitter: 32 bits An estimate of your statistical variance of the RTP facts packet interarrival time, calculated in timestamp units and expressed as an unsigned integer. The interarrival jitter J is defined being the signify deviation (smoothed complete worth) of the difference D in packet spacing for the receiver in comparison to the sender to get a pair of packets. As shown in the equation underneath, This is often reminiscent of the main difference from the "relative transit time" for the two packets; Schulzrinne, et al. Expectations Observe [Webpage 39]

The movement have to be submitted on or prior to the 60th working day ahead of the demo date Until the courtroom finds excellent bring about to enable the motion to generally be filed at a later on day.

In Photoshop, when conserving as PNG, why is the scale of my output file larger Once i have much more invisible layers in the first file?

Considering the fact that its inception, the inspiration has expanded the Frontier RTP principle to three added properties, building An inexpensive campus for increasing tech, lifestyle science and nonprofit businesses; as of 2021, 100 on the Park's three hundred companies are housed in the Frontier campus.

RFC 3550 RTP July 2003 Someone RTP participant Ought to mail only one compound RTCP packet for every report interval in order for the RTCP bandwidth for each participant for being believed properly (see Part 6.2), apart from once the compound RTCP packet is break up for partial encryption as described in Section nine.one. If you will discover too many resources to fit all the mandatory RR packets into a person compound RTCP packet with no exceeding the most transmission unit (MTU) on the community path, then just the subset that will healthy into a single MTU Needs to be included in each interval. The subsets Needs to be picked round-robin throughout several intervals so that every one sources are reported. It is RECOMMENDED that translators and mixers Mix specific RTCP packets from your various resources they are forwarding into just one compound packet whenever feasible in an effort to amortize the packet overhead (see Portion 7). An instance RTCP compound packet as may be made by a mixer is shown in Fig. 1. If the overall length of a compound packet would exceed the MTU in the community route, it SHOULD be segmented into various shorter compound packets for being transmitted in independent packets of the fundamental protocol.

4. The sampling immediate is decided on as The purpose of reference for the RTP timestamp since it is understood into the transmitting endpoint and it has a standard definition for all media, impartial of encoding delays or other processing. The intent is to allow synchronized presentation of all media sampled concurrently. Applications transmitting saved data in lieu of facts sampled in true time usually make use of a Digital presentation timeline derived from wallclock time to determine when the subsequent body or other device of each medium during the saved information really should be presented. In this case, the RTP timestamp would replicate the presentation time for each device. Which is, the RTP timestamp for each device will be associated with the wallclock time at which the device gets existing on the virtual presentation timeline. Actual presentation happens some time later as based on the receiver. An example describing Are living audio narration of prerecorded movie illustrates the significance of choosing the sampling instant given that the reference position. On this state of affairs, the video clip could well be introduced locally for the narrator to watch and will be simultaneously transmitted employing RTP. The "sampling instantaneous" of a movie frame transmitted in RTP might be set up by referencing Schulzrinne, et al. Specifications Keep track of [Webpage fifteen]

RFC 3550 RTP July 2003 Independent audio and video clip streams SHOULD NOT be carried in only one RTP session and demultiplexed based on the payload sort or SSRC fields. Interleaving packets with different RTP media types but using the same SSRC would introduce various issues: 1. If, say, two audio streams shared precisely the same RTP session and precisely the same SSRC price, and a single were being to vary encodings and thus acquire a different RTP payload style, there can be no common way of determining which stream had improved encodings. two. An SSRC is defined to detect an individual timing and sequence quantity House. Interleaving a number of payload kinds would need distinctive timing spaces When the media clock fees differ and would need various sequence number spaces to tell which payload kind experienced packet reduction. three. The RTCP sender and receiver stories (see Part six.four) can only describe one timing and sequence amount space for each SSRC and do not have a payload variety area. four. An RTP mixer would not be able to Merge interleaved streams of incompatible media into one stream.

The online market place, like other packet networks, at times loses and reorders packets and delays them by variable quantities of time. To manage Using these impairments, the RTP header consists of timing facts as well as a sequence selection that enable the receivers to reconstruct the timing produced by the resource, in order that in this example, chunks of audio are contiguously played out the speaker every single 20 ms. This timing reconstruction is executed net33 separately for each supply of RTP packets inside the convention. The sequence range can even be employed by the receiver to estimate the number of packets are increasingly being dropped. Since associates in the Doing the job team join and leave during the meeting, it is helpful to know that's participating at any moment And the way properly They're getting the audio information. For that function, each occasion of your audio application during the conference periodically multicasts a reception report in addition the name of its user within the RTCP (Management) port. The reception report implies how properly The present speaker is remaining received and could be utilised to control adaptive encodings. Besides the person identify, other pinpointing information and facts may be provided subject to regulate bandwidth restrictions. A website sends the RTCP BYE packet (Part six.6) when it leaves the convention. Schulzrinne, et al. Requirements Track [Web page 6]

Report this page